DevOps Engineer (REF1048M)
📍 Job Overview
- Job Title: DevOps Engineer (REF1048M)
- Company: Mirantis
- Location: Austin, Texas, United States
- Job Type: Full-time
- Category: DevOps Engineer
- Date Posted: June 27, 2025
- Experience Level: Mid-Senior level (5-10 years)
- Remote Status: Remote OK
🚀 Role Summary
Mirantis, a Kubernetes-native AI infrastructure company, seeks a DevOps Engineer to provide technical guidance and consulting to enterprise customers. This role involves leading proof of concept implementations, presenting platform strategies, and developing best practices for containerizing applications and enhancing Kubernetes. The ideal candidate will have a strong background in Kubernetes, Docker, CI/CD tools, and cloud platforms.
📝 Enhancement Note: This role requires a balance of technical depth and breadth, with a focus on Kubernetes and cloud platforms. The candidate should be comfortable working with enterprise customers and have strong communication skills to present platform strategies effectively.
💻 Primary Responsibilities
- Technical Guidance & Consulting: Provide expert guidance and consulting to enterprise class customers and their development and operations teams.
- Proof of Concept & Pilot Implementations: Lead proof of concept and pilot implementations of the platform within key customer accounts.
- Platform Strategy & Roadmap: Present platform strategy, concepts, and roadmap to technical leaders within the customer's organization.
- Best Practices Development: Develop best practices and guidance for containerizing various application platforms, tro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
- Kubernetes Enhancement: Enhance Kubernetes by developing and maintaining Kubernetes extensions (CRDs, operators, and webhooks) and establishing best practices around the usage of Lens and extensions to enhance Kubernetes.
- Customer Advocacy & Partner Enablement: Serve as a customer advocate to other Mirantis teams and enable partners to develop service delivery skills through mentorship, training, and engagement shadowing.
- Skills Propagation: Help propagate skills and experience through the development of repeatable assets such as methodologies, blueprints, tools, white papers, and knowledge articles.
📝 Enhancement Note: The candidate should be prepared to work with various Kubernetes distributions, including open source, public cloud (EKS, AKS, GKE), Rancher, and OpenShift. They should also be comfortable working with different cloud platforms, such as AWS, Azure, and GCP.
🎓 Skills & Qualifications
Education: Bachelor's degree or foreign degree equivalent in Computer Science, Telecommunication, Electronic Engineering, or a related field.
Experience: Five (5) years of post-baccalaureate progressive experience in job offered, Software Engineer, Software Developer, Systems Engineer, or in a related occupation.
Required Skills:
- Kubernetes
- Docker
- CI/CD tools (Jenkins, Gitlab CI, or CircleCI)
- Cloud platforms (AWS, Azure, or GCP)
- Prometheus, Grafana, or ELK stack
- Git
- Terraform, CloudFormation, or Ansible
Preferred Skills:
- Experience with enterprise customers
- Strong communication and presentation skills
- Familiarity with various Kubernetes distributions and cloud platforms
- Ability to develop and maintain Kubernetes extensions
📊 Web Portfolio & Project Requirements
Portfolio Essentials:
- Demonstrate experience with Kubernetes, Docker, and CI/CD tools through relevant projects and case studies.
- Showcase your ability to enhance Kubernetes and develop best practices for containerizing applications.
- Highlight your experience with cloud platforms and enterprise customers.
Technical Documentation:
- Provide examples of best practices and guidance documents for containerizing applications and enhancing Kubernetes.
- Include case studies or success stories demonstrating your ability to lead proof of concept implementations and present platform strategies.
- Showcase your ability to troubleshoot application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
💵 Compensation & Benefits
Salary Range: $120,000 - $180,000 per year (based on regional market rates for a mid-senior level DevOps Engineer in Austin, TX)
Benefits:
- Professional development and training
- Attend conferences and working groups
- Company outings, happy hours, hackathons, and tech talks
- Competitive compensation with a strong benefits plan
Working Hours: Full-time (40 hours/week) with flexible hours and the option to work remotely.
📝 Enhancement Note: The salary range provided is an estimate based on regional market rates for a mid-senior level DevOps Engineer in Austin, TX. Actual salary may vary based on factors such as experience, skills, and company-specific compensation policies.
🎯 Team & Company Context
🏢 Company Culture
Industry: Mirantis operates in the cloud infrastructure industry, focusing on Kubernetes-native AI infrastructure for modern AI, machine learning, and data-intensive applications.
Company Size: Mirantis is an established Silicon Valley leader with a high-energy environment that values openness, collaboration, risk-taking, and continuous growth.
Founded: 2011
Team Structure:
- The DevOps Engineer will work closely with enterprise customers and their development and operations teams.
- They will also collaborate with other Mirantis teams, such as Product Development, Sales & Marketing, and partners to enable service delivery skills.
- The role may involve working with various Kubernetes distributions and cloud platforms, requiring cross-functional collaboration with different teams.
Development Methodology:
- Mirantis follows Agile methodologies for software development and delivery.
- The DevOps Engineer will work with customers to implement best practices around C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
- They will also develop and maintain Kubernetes extensions and establish best practices around the usage of Lens and extensions to enhance Kubernetes.
Company Website: https://www.mirantis.com/
📝 Enhancement Note: Mirantis' company culture emphasizes open-source innovation, collaboration, and continuous growth. The DevOps Engineer should be comfortable working with enterprise customers and collaborating with cross-functional teams to deliver cutting-edge cloud infrastructure solutions.
📈 Career & Growth Analysis
Web Technology Career Level: The DevOps Engineer role at Mirantis is a mid-senior level position that requires a strong background in Kubernetes, Docker, CI/CD tools, and cloud platforms. The ideal candidate will have experience working with enterprise customers and presenting platform strategies effectively.
Reporting Structure: The DevOps Engineer will report directly to the Manager of Technical Services or a similar role within the organization. They will work closely with enterprise customers and collaborate with other Mirantis teams to deliver cutting-edge cloud infrastructure solutions.
Technical Impact: The DevOps Engineer will have a significant impact on the success of Mirantis' customers by providing technical guidance and consulting, leading proof of concept implementations, and developing best practices for containerizing applications and enhancing Kubernetes. They will also enable partners to develop service delivery skills and help propagate skills and experience through the development of repeatable assets.
Growth Opportunities:
- Technical Growth: The DevOps Engineer can grow their technical skills by working with various Kubernetes distributions, cloud platforms, and enterprise customers. They can also enhance their expertise in Kubernetes extensions and best practices.
- Leadership Development: As the DevOps Engineer gains experience and demonstrates success in their role, they may have the opportunity to take on more leadership responsibilities, such as mentoring junior team members or leading technical projects.
- Architecture Decisions: The DevOps Engineer may have the opportunity to influence architecture decisions for Mirantis' customers and contribute to the development of repeatable assets, such as methodologies, blueprints, tools, white papers, and knowledge articles.
📝 Enhancement Note: The DevOps Engineer role at Mirantis offers significant growth opportunities for technical and leadership development. The ideal candidate will be eager to learn and grow with the company as it continues to innovate in the cloud infrastructure industry.
🌐 Work Environment
Office Type: Mirantis has a high-energy, collaborative work environment that values openness, collaboration, risk-taking, and continuous growth. The company offers a mix of on-site and remote work options, with the opportunity to work from home or in one of their offices.
Office Location(s): Mirantis has offices in various locations, including Austin, TX, and other global locations. The DevOps Engineer role is open to remote work, with the option to work from home or in one of Mirantis' offices.
Workspace Context:
- Collaborative Workspace: The DevOps Engineer will work in a collaborative environment with enterprise customers and other Mirantis teams. They will need to be comfortable working with remote teams and collaborating with stakeholders across different time zones.
- Development Tools: The DevOps Engineer will have access to the tools and resources necessary to perform their job effectively, including access to various Kubernetes distributions, cloud platforms, and enterprise customer environments.
- Cross-Functional Collaboration: The DevOps Engineer will collaborate with various teams within Mirantis, such as Product Development, Sales & Marketing, and partners to deliver cutting-edge cloud infrastructure solutions.
Work Schedule: The DevOps Engineer will work full-time (40 hours/week) with flexible hours and the option to work remotely. They may need to adjust their work schedule to accommodate customer time zones and project deadlines.
📝 Enhancement Note: The DevOps Engineer role at Mirantis offers a flexible work environment that balances collaboration and remote work. The ideal candidate will be comfortable working with remote teams and collaborating with stakeholders across different time zones.
📄 Application & Technical Interview Process
Interview Process:
- Technical Assessment: The first step in the interview process will be a technical assessment, focusing on the candidate's knowledge of Kubernetes, Docker, CI/CD tools, and cloud platforms. The assessment may include a coding challenge or a review of the candidate's portfolio.
- Customer Engagement: The next step will involve a discussion about the candidate's experience working with enterprise customers and their ability to present platform strategies effectively. The candidate may be asked to provide examples of their work with enterprise customers or to present a mock platform strategy.
- Technical Deep Dive: The final step in the interview process will be a technical deep dive, focusing on the candidate's ability to enhance Kubernetes and develop best practices for containerizing applications. The candidate may be asked to demonstrate their ability to develop and maintain Kubernetes extensions or to discuss their approach to tro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
Portfolio Review Tips:
- Demonstrate Relevant Projects: Highlight projects that demonstrate your experience with Kubernetes, Docker, CI/CD tools, and cloud platforms.
- Showcase Customer Engagement: Include examples of your work with enterprise customers and your ability to present platform strategies effectively.
- Highlight Technical Depth: Demonstrate your ability to enhance Kubernetes and develop best practices for containerizing applications by including examples of your work with Kubernetes extensions or best practices for tro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
Technical Challenge Preparation:
- Brush Up on Technical Skills: Review your knowledge of Kubernetes, Docker, CI/CD tools, and cloud platforms in preparation for the technical assessment.
- Practice Coding Challenges: Familiarize yourself with common coding challenges and practice solving them to prepare for the technical assessment.
- Prepare for Customer Engagement: Research Mirantis' customers and prepare examples of your work with enterprise customers to demonstrate your ability to present platform strategies effectively.
ATS Keywords:
- Programming Languages: Kubernetes, Docker, Python, Bash, Go, Java, JavaScript
- Web Frameworks: None specified
- Server Technologies: Kubernetes, Docker, Cloud Platforms (AWS, Azure, GCP), Prometheus, Grafana, ELK Stack, Git, Terraform, CloudFormation, Ansible
- Databases: None specified
- Tools: Jenkins, Gitlab CI, CircleCI, AWS, Azure, GCP, Prometheus, Grafana, ELK Stack, Git, Terraform, CloudFormation, Ansible
- Methodologies: Agile, Scrum, CI/CD, DevOps
- Soft Skills: Communication, Presentation, Collaboration, Problem-Solving, Troubleshooting
- Industry Terms: Kubernetes, Docker, CI/CD, Cloud Platforms, Enterprise Customers, Platform Strategies, Best Practices, Containerization, Enhance Kubernetes, Technical Guidance, Consulting, Proof of Concept, Pilot Implementations, Customer Advocacy, Partner Enablement, Skills Propagation, Methodologies, Blueprints, Tools, White Papers, Knowledge Articles
📝 Enhancement Note: The interview process for the DevOps Engineer role at Mirantis is designed to assess the candidate's technical skills, customer engagement, and technical depth. The ideal candidate will have a strong background in Kubernetes, Docker, CI/CD tools, and cloud platforms, as well as experience working with enterprise customers and presenting platform strategies effectively.
🛠 Technology Stack & Web Infrastructure
Frontend Technologies: N/A (DevOps Engineer role focuses on backend and infrastructure technologies)
Backend & Server Technologies:
- Kubernetes
- Docker
- Cloud Platforms (AWS, Azure, GCP)
- Prometheus
- Grafana
- ELK Stack
- Git
- Terraform
- CloudFormation
- Ansible
Development & DevOps Tools:
- CI/CD Tools (Jenkins, Gitlab CI, CircleCI)
- Cloud Platforms (AWS, Azure, GCP)
- Prometheus
- Grafana
- ELK Stack
- Git
- Terraform
- CloudFormation
- Ansible
📝 Enhancement Note: The DevOps Engineer role at Mirantis requires a strong background in Kubernetes, Docker, CI/CD tools, and cloud platforms. The ideal candidate will have experience working with various Kubernetes distributions, cloud platforms, and enterprise customers.
👥 Team Culture & Values
Web Development Values:
- Customer Focus: Mirantis places a strong emphasis on customer success and ensuring that their customers achieve their desired outcomes. The DevOps Engineer should be committed to providing technical guidance and consulting to enterprise customers and helping them implement cutting-edge cloud infrastructure solutions.
- Innovation: Mirantis values open-source innovation and encourages its team members to explore new technologies and approaches to problem-solving. The DevOps Engineer should be eager to learn and adapt to new technologies and best practices in the cloud infrastructure industry.
- Collaboration: Mirantis fosters a collaborative work environment that encourages team members to work together to achieve common goals. The DevOps Engineer should be comfortable working with remote teams and collaborating with stakeholders across different time zones.
- Continuous Learning: Mirantis values continuous learning and encourages its team members to develop their skills and knowledge throughout their careers. The DevOps Engineer should be committed to staying up-to-date with the latest trends and best practices in the cloud infrastructure industry.
Collaboration Style:
- Cross-Functional Integration: The DevOps Engineer will collaborate with various teams within Mirantis, such as Product Development, Sales & Marketing, and partners to deliver cutting-edge cloud infrastructure solutions.
- Code Review Culture: Mirantis follows best practices for code review and encourages its team members to review each other's work to ensure quality and consistency.
- Knowledge Sharing: Mirantis values knowledge sharing and encourages its team members to share their expertise and experiences with their colleagues. The DevOps Engineer should be willing to mentor junior team members and contribute to the development of repeatable assets, such as methodologies, blueprints, tools, white papers, and knowledge articles.
📝 Enhancement Note: The DevOps Engineer role at Mirantis requires a strong commitment to customer success, innovation, collaboration, and continuous learning. The ideal candidate will be comfortable working with remote teams and collaborating with stakeholders across different time zones to deliver cutting-edge cloud infrastructure solutions.
⚡ Challenges & Growth Opportunities
Technical Challenges:
- Kubernetes Enhancement: Develop and maintain Kubernetes extensions (CRDs, operators, and webhooks) to enhance Kubernetes and establish best practices around the usage of Lens and extensions.
- Enterprise Customer Engagement: Work with enterprise customers to present platform strategies, concepts, and roadmaps effectively. Develop best practices for containerizing various application platforms and tro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
- Cloud Platform Expertise: Gain expertise in various cloud platforms, such as AWS, Azure, and GCP, and work with different Kubernetes distributions, such as open source, public cloud (EKS, AKS, GKE), Rancher, and OpenShift.
- Emerging Technologies: Stay up-to-date with the latest trends and best practices in the cloud infrastructure industry, and be prepared to adapt to new technologies and approaches as they emerge.
Learning & Development Opportunities:
- Technical Skill Development: The DevOps Engineer role at Mirantis offers significant opportunities for technical skill development, including working with various Kubernetes distributions, cloud platforms, and enterprise customers.
- Conference Attendance: Mirantis encourages its team members to attend conferences and working groups to stay up-to-date with the latest trends and best practices in the cloud infrastructure industry.
- Certification & Community Involvement: The DevOps Engineer may have the opportunity to pursue certifications or become involved in cloud infrastructure communities to further develop their skills and knowledge.
- Technical Mentorship: The DevOps Engineer may have the opportunity to mentor junior team members or receive mentorship from more senior team members to develop their technical skills and leadership abilities.
📝 Enhancement Note: The DevOps Engineer role at Mirantis presents significant technical challenges and growth opportunities for the ideal candidate. The ideal candidate will be eager to learn and adapt to new technologies and approaches in the cloud infrastructure industry.
💡 Interview Preparation
Technical Questions:
- Kubernetes & Docker: Be prepared to discuss your experience with Kubernetes and Docker, including your ability to enhance Kubernetes and develop best practices for containerizing applications.
- CI/CD Tools & Cloud Platforms: Demonstrate your expertise in CI/CD tools and cloud platforms, and be prepared to discuss your experience working with enterprise customers and presenting platform strategies effectively.
- Troubleshooting & Problem-Solving: Showcase your ability to troubleshoot application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
Company & Culture Questions:
- Customer Focus: Be prepared to discuss your commitment to customer success and your experience working with enterprise customers to deliver cutting-edge cloud infrastructure solutions.
- Innovation & Collaboration: Demonstrate your eagerness to learn and adapt to new technologies and approaches, as well as your ability to collaborate with remote teams and stakeholders across different time zones.
- Continuous Learning: Showcase your commitment to staying up-to-date with the latest trends and best practices in the cloud infrastructure industry, and be prepared to discuss your approach to continuous learning and professional development.
Portfolio Presentation Strategy:
- Demonstrate Relevant Projects: Highlight projects that demonstrate your experience with Kubernetes, Docker, CI/CD tools, and cloud platforms, as well as your ability to work with enterprise customers and present platform strategies effectively.
- Showcase Technical Depth: Include examples of your work with Kubernetes extensions or best practices for tro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
- Highlight Customer Engagement: Demonstrate your ability to work with enterprise customers and present platform strategies effectively by including examples of your work with enterprise customers or a mock platform strategy presentation.
📝 Enhancement Note: The interview process for the DevOps Engineer role at Mirantis is designed to assess the candidate's technical skills, customer engagement, and technical depth. The ideal candidate will have a strong background in Kubernetes, Docker, CI/CD tools, and cloud platforms, as well as experience working with enterprise customers and presenting platform strategies effectively.
📌 Application Steps
To apply for this DevOps Engineer position at Mirantis:
- Submit your application through the application link provided in the job listing.
- Customize your resume and portfolio to highlight your experience with Kubernetes, Docker, CI/CD tools, and cloud platforms, as well as your ability to work with enterprise customers and present platform strategies effectively.
- Prepare for the technical assessment by reviewing your knowledge of Kubernetes, Docker, CI/CD tools, and cloud platforms, and practicing coding challenges to improve your problem-solving skills.
- Research Mirantis' customers and prepare examples of your work with enterprise customers to demonstrate your ability to present platform strategies effectively.
- Prepare for the technical deep dive by reviewing your knowledge of Kubernetes extensions and best practices for troubleshooting application issues, CICD, logging, monitoring, security, and capacity analysis for a Kubernetes-rich environment.
⚠️ Important Notice: This enhanced job description includes AI-generated insights and web development/server administration industry-standard assumptions. All details should be verified directly with the hiring organization before making application decisions.
Application Requirements
Candidates must have a Bachelor's degree in a related field and five years of progressive experience in DevOps or related roles. Experience with Kubernetes, Docker, CI/CD tools, and cloud platforms is essential.